We have an opportunity for a Logistics Specialist to join our Delavan, WI team. You will help manage distribution/logistics activities for the IFT Segment. It will require interaction and collaboration with the Distribution and Logistics team members. This position requires the ability to organize and complete a daily workload. Responsibilities include, working with Pentair Logistics team to file international documents per Compliance requirements and supporting the Distribution team.
You Will
- Utilize various transportation provider software systems to facilitate documentation printing and upload.
- Helping carriers and logistics department to assure efficient and effective execution of transportation
- Organize and maintain logistics documentation.
- Understand and comply with all state, federal, environmental, safety, and hazardous material regulations as they pertain to transportation.
- Participates in planning sessions and help with projects in support of department objectives.
- Assist as needed in preparing BOL’s and other related documents.
- Drive for efficiency and demonstrate the ability to resolve issues through research and communication skills.
- Demonstrates the capacity to understand department and business objectives.
- Interact with Distribution and assist with Lean Activities such as 5S, Material Flow, cycle counting programs.
- It will require interaction and collaboration with Operations, Buyers, and Distribution. This position requires the ability to prioritize a complex and changing workload to meet project deadlines and cost goals.
- As part of a team, demonstrates initiative and interacts at a professional level.
- Lead claim recovery activities for IF.
- Manage other activities as assigned by the manager.
- High School degree or equivalent
- Comfortable working with Microsoft systems such as, Microsoft Excel, SharePoint, and Outlook.
- SAP knowledge a plus.
- Strong Excel skills to create, organize and maintain data.
- 2 years’ experience in Distribution or Logistics atmosphere preferred.
- Highly self-motivated individual with desire to continue to expand and grow with the organization.
